Second teenager set to be charged over Townsville crash which claimed life of woman

Published

on

A man who was allegedly driving a stolen car involved in a crash that killed a young motorcyclist near Townsville has been arrested.

Police say 22-year-old Jennifer Board died at Thuringowa on Friday night after being hit by a Holden Statesman, which had collided with the stolen Hyundai sedan during a suspected vigilante pursuit.

Officers confirmed an 18-year-old man was arrested in the Townsville suburb of Rasmussen on Monday morning.

He expected to be the charged later in the day.
